Maintenance Technician
On-site · Dallas, Texas, United States
Job Summary
Maintenance Technician for a residential property responsible for completing service requests across common areas and units, performing plumbing, electrical, HVAC, carpentry, painting, lighting, and landscaping tasks, inspecting appliances and safety devices, assisting with trash outs and unit turns, and performing routine maintenance and repairs. Must demonstrate strong customer service, initiative to identify and correct hazards, and the ability to work with residents and maintenance staff. Hours listed as 9:00 a.m.–6:00 p.m. (Mon–Fri) and 10:00 a.m.–5:00 p.m. (Sat) with rotating on-call after-hours/weekend duties. Location is Dallas, TX. Requires valid driver license and EPA HVAC Type II or Universal Certification.
Required Qualifications
- Valid driver license and auto liability insurance is required
- HVAC certification: Type II or Universal EPA Certification is required
